Early Life and Education
Ahmad Rashad, born Robert Earl Moore Jr., was raised in Portland, Oregon. He attended Mount Tahoma High School in Tacoma, Washington, where his athletic prowess began to shine. Rashad’s talent on the field earned him a scholarship to the University of Oregon, where he played college football and was named an All-American. His early years were marked by dedication to sports, laying the groundwork for his future success.
Professional Football Career
Rashad’s professional football career began in 1972 when he was drafted by the St. Louis Cardinals as the fourth overall pick in the NFL Draft. Over the next decade, he played for several teams, including the Buffalo Bills and the Minnesota Vikings. His career highlights include four Pro Bowl selections and numerous memorable moments on the field. By the time he retired in 1982, Rashad had solidified his reputation as a formidable wide receiver.
Transition to Broadcasting
After retiring from professional football, Rashad transitioned to broadcasting, a move that would significantly impact his net worth. He began his career in sports journalism with NBC Sports in 1983, quickly becoming a household name. His charismatic presence and deep understanding of the game made him a favorite among viewers.
Rise to Fame in Broadcasting
Rashad’s rise to fame in broadcasting was meteoric. He became the host of "NBA Inside Stuff," a popular show that provided an insider’s look at the NBA. His engaging style and rapport with players and fans alike made the show a huge success.
